River Raisin National Battlefield Park, partnering with the Friends of the River Raisin Battlefield and the City of Monroe, will be hosting the 211th Anniversary Commemoration Event on Saturday, January 20, 2024, running from 11:00 a.m. until 4:00 p.m.

Programs include a tactical demonstration by the Friends of the River Raisin Battlefield, a wreath-laying ceremony by the National Park Service, and the showing of new educational films produced by the National Park Service.

A special presentation of artifacts belonging to American Brigadier General James Winchester will be presented by Cragfont Historic Site, Winchester’s home and now a Tennessee State Historic Site. General Winchester was the leader of the American forces during the Battles of the River Raisin.
